Karakterisasi Bakteri dan Jamur yang Berpotensi Sebagai Mikroba Endofit Asal Kulit Buah Kakao (Theobroma cacao L.) Unggul Sulawesi-2
Cacao (Theobroma cacao L.) has potential to symbiosis with endophytic microbes. These microorganisms have a symbiotic mutualism with host plants. The group of endophytic bacteria are produce antibiotics, anti-cancer, anti-fungal, anti-viral, volatile compounds, even insecticides, while endophytic fungi is a biological control agents. This study were aimed to isolate and characterize bacteria and fungi that have the potential as endophytic microbes from Sulawesi's superior cacao (T. cacao L.). The method used in this study was descriptive method to determine the characterization of bacteria and fungi that have the potential as endophytic microbes, the results showed that there were 2 bacterial isolates who has a different morphology and 1 fungal isolate suspected genus Aspergilus.
